Silica sand for solar glass manufacturing plays a direct role in determining the optical properties of the final product: Transmittance: Solar glass requires >91% light transmission in the visible and near-infrared spectra. Low Haze Levels: Achieved through the purity and proper processing of silica sand.

Semiconductor-grade glass. Specialty coatings. Silica sand is a critical raw material for producing the high-performance solar glass essential to photovoltaic and solar thermal technologies. Its purity, particle size, and low impurity content are paramount in achieving the optical, thermal, and mechanical properties required for solar panels.
The growing demand for solar panels has increased the need for ultra-high-purity silica sand. Key challenges include: Resource Scarcity: High-purity deposits are limited. Processing Costs: Advanced purification methods increase operational costs. Environmental Impact: Mining and processing can disrupt ecosystems.

To achieve high solar energy conversion, the total iron content must be strictly controlled, usually below 100 ppm, and for premium ultra-clear glass, even below 80 ppm.
